Christopher Columbus was born in Genoa, Italy in 1451. As a boy he became initiated to sailing by one of his kinsmen (a sea captain), which is what forced him to become a Spanish navigator. He pleaded with the Spanish and the French governments, Spain's King Ferdinand V and Queen Isabella I gave him a grant to lead an expedition to the west across the Atlantic Ocean in search of new routes to Asia. He wasn't very successful in finding new routes to Asia but he got the credit of discovering the Americas, Jamaica, Hispaniola and many more islands found in the New World. Columbus sailed to the New World in search of a western route to the Indies. Upon Columbus' arrival to the New World he found some islanders. He thought that he had arrived at an island of the East Indies near Japan or China so he named the islanders Indians. It was not until thirty years after that people found out that Columbus hadn't really been to Asia. Columbus' goals caused him to mistreat the humble, innocent indigenous people he found on the island. Among the evil thing Columbus did to the Indians were: "At one part of the island he got into a fight with the Indians who refused to trade as many bows and arrows as he and his men wanted. Two were run through with swords and bled to death" (Zinn 3) and "Haiti, where he and his men imagined huge gold fields to exist, they ordered all persons fourteen years or older to collect a certain quantity of gold every three months. When they brought it, they were given copper tokens to hang around their necks. Indians found without a copper token had their hands cut off and bled to death." (Zinn 4) When there was no more gold to accumulate from the Indians, Columbus started using them as slave labor on huge plantations (encomiendas), they were worked so badly. Columbus and his crew also forced their way into native settlements and slaughtered everyone they found there, including small children, old men, pregnant women, and even women who had just given birth. They hacked them to pieces, slicing open their bellies with their swords as though they were butchering a cow.
